One added thought. My Charger 500 is one of the early XS versus XX Vin cars. I put the wrong one on the application when I registered my car. In North Carolina, all classic cars are physically checked by a state trooper before issuing the registration, said trooper lectured me on my error. His comment...the VIN on the dash matters, the state could care less about the tag, as he said that is for you “crazy hobby guys!”.
